Principal / Associate Structural Engineer


Gateshead


Salary up to £65k


Calibre Search are working alongside a growing, privately owned Consultancy in the North East who consistently deliver a variety of schemes throughout the UK. Due to a healthy forward workload, they are currently looking to appoint a Senior level Structural Engineer to come in at either Principal or Associate level to help grow the business and build a team around.


Their experienced team help to deliver the whole life cycle of a scheme from Feasibility/Appraisal Stage to Planning Stage to Detailed Design Stage through to Construction Completion, ongoing maintenance and operation. Their current team has vast Engineering and practical experience in delivering schemes in all sectors including Residential, Commercial/Retail, Industrial, Student Accommodation, Sport & Leisure, Education and Heritage.


As well as having the ability to manage projects, providing support, mentoring and guidance to less experienced colleagues, you will take initiative and manage your own workload/deadlines. The role will require you to review documents, designs and drawings completed by team to ensure consistent high quality and compliance with design standards, industry best practice, contractual obligations and client expectations.


Possessing a minimum of seven years UK industry experience, you will be able to act as Technical lead on projects large and small. You will liaise with and lead other members of the design team to achieve a coordinated design solution that meets the Clients objectives. You will carry out structural engineering assessment and inspections of new and existing properties in steel, concrete, masonry and timber.


Undertaking analysis and design using a range of software packages including Tekla Structural Designer and FastTrack Building Designer, you will be responsible for preparing high quality technical reports including structural surveys and ensuring that quality and consistency of technical output (drawings, reports etc.) is maintained.


As a Chartered or near Chartered Engineer, you have varied experience in all the common forms of construction and building types and be experienced in the use of Eurocodes. Excellent report writing, communication and numerical skills are required, as is experience of structural analysis design and software essential.


The role offers an opportunity to provide design solutions on a large portfolio of projects, and to work within a friendly and professional team that is proud of the quality of the service it delivers to its clients. They have a clear vision for innovation and engineering excellence.


This opportunity offers a competitive salary and excellent flexible benefits package for permanent staff which includes training opportunities, reimbursement of professional fees, contributory pension, personal health care plan and life insurance, interest-free travel loan scheme, additional leave purchase and buy-back scheme, staff loyalty bonus.


A full UK Drivers license is required for this role
